Choosing the Right Exterminator Service: Just How to Contrast Pest Control Companies Like a Pro

You can cope with a squeaky door, a crooked photo frame, a confusing ice manufacturer. You can not live with cockroaches in the kitchen, bed insects in the headboard, or woodworker ants in the sill plate. When you choose to call a pest control service, the risks really feel instant and individual. The wrong option can be pricey, inefficient, and in some cases dangerous. The best exterminator service addresses the problem, avoids it from returning, and leaves you with info you can use. The challenge is sorting via ads, guarantees, plans, and assures to discover the business that will in fact do the job.

Over the last years managing business facilities and remodeling older homes, I have actually employed, rested with, and trailed pest control contractors in basements, creep rooms, attics, and dining establishments at 4 a.m. Some companies sent out service technicians who were encyclopedias. Others sent out respectful folks who did little more than established adhesive traps. Patterns arised. You can detect a top quality exterminator company before you ever authorize an agreement if you recognize what to ask, what to expect, and exactly how to contrast propositions side by side.

The issue under your feet, in the walls, and behind the fridge

Pest troubles come under three pails. Architectural insects, such as termites, carpenter ants, and powderpost beetles, endanger the building itself. Cleanliness insects, such as cockroaches, flies, and rats, thrive on food resources and dampness. Occasional invaders, like silverfish or centipedes, manipulate openings and conditions but do not always nest in your house. Each group requires a different approach, and a great pest control company will customize the strategy accordingly.

When I walked a 1920s bungalow with a brand-new home owner who kept hearing pale rustling during the night, the very first specialist she called recommended a perennial general service, regular monthly sees, and a rodent bait station bundle for the exterior. He never ever climbed up right into the attic room. A competitor invested fifteen mins with a headlamp in the eaves, then showed us a two-inch void at the fascia and numerous droppings along the knee wall. The 2nd contractor secured the access factor, set traps in details runway locations, eliminated the carcasses, and followed up twice. This task cost much less than 2 months of the very first strategy and finished the issue within a week. Great pest control starts with inspection, not with a sales script.

What a reliable assessment looks like

If the very first check out lasts five mins and finishes with a laminated price sheet, keep looking. An appropriate examination has a rhythm. Outdoors, a service technician circles the structure, downspouts, and plant life clearance, checking for conducive problems such as wood-to-soil contact, wet compost versus exterior siding, and gaps at energy penetrations. Inside your home, they adhere to dampness and warmth. Kitchens, shower rooms, laundry room, cellar sills, and attic room ventilation all get an appearance. They might ask to relocate the stove cabinet or look under a sink base. If rats are thought, they check for rub marks, droppings, and chomp points at door edges. For termites, they seek sanctuary tubes, blistered paint, or soft places in walls. For bed pests, they peel back seams and check tufts.

A skilled exterminator narrates as they go, also if briefly. You will listen to remarks like, "These droppings are consistent with computer m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equivalent length." They might utilize a moisture meter on suspicious wood or a flashlight at ground degree to spot ants routing throughout the heat of the day. The devices do not require to be fancy. Curiosity issues greater than equipment.

Credentials that in fact matter

Licensing and insurance are the bare minimum. You want a pest control company that holds the correct state licenses for architectural pest control and, when called for, a different license for bed insect or termite treatments. Ask to see proof of basic obligation and workers' payment insurance coverage. I have actually seen attic room joists broken by a negligent action, overspray on a vehicle, and ladder dents in seamless gutters. Insurance is there due to the fact that mishaps happen.

Beyond licensing, seek proof of proceeding education and learning. In several states, specialists need a number of CEUs yearly to keep their credential. When a business buys training, you see it in the field decisions. During a heat wave one summer season, I saw a technology swap out a fluid ant lure for a gel because the colony had shifted to healthy protein. That choice originates from method and training.

Experience by insect kind matters greater than years in company. A newer pest control contractor that treats bed bugs once a week often outshines a big exterminator company that sends out a generalist two times a year. Ask, "How many bed bug tasks have you completed this year? What is your re-treatment rate? What are the usual reasons when they fall short?" Listen for certain numbers or arrays and honest explanations.

The plan ought to match the pest, the structure, and your tolerance

A decent exterminator service will recommend an integrated strategy. You may hear the phrase IPM, incorporated bug administration. Water, food, and harborage reduction precede. Chemical controls, when utilized, are exact and targeted.

For rats, an excellent strategy starts with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ized holes for mice, larger for rats, with steel woollen and caulk or equipment fabric. Traps within, lure stations outside where permitted, and sanitation actions like sealed animal food go together. If a proposition leans on poisonous substance inside living spaces without a plan to eliminate carcasses or seal entry factors, that is careless and short-sighted.

For roaches, sanitation and accessibility matter as long as chemical choice. I as soon as dealt with a restaurant that reduced German roach counts by 80 percent in 3 weeks just by closing flooring drainpipe gaps with stainless inserts and adding nighttime wipe-down procedures. The pest control company switched to a turning of growth regulatory authorities and lures, applied as pin-sized beads, not program sprays. The mix stuck due to the fact that the setting changed.

For termites, the decision frequently boils down to soil therapies versus lures. A liquid termiticide forms a treated zone that termites can not cross. It offers immediate security yet needs boring and trenching. Bait systems, such as those free inspection and estimate installed around the perimeter, can remove nests gradually and are less intrusive, yet they need monitoring and persistence. An excellent exterminator sets out both courses with pros, disadvantages, and expenses, then points to problems on your building that suggestion the choice. Hefty clay dirt, high water tables, slab building, or historic block can all affect the treatment choice.

For bed insects, heat, chemical, or integrated approaches all function when performed well. Whole-home heat treatments get to deadly temperatures for a sustained time. They need prep work, get rid of chemical deposits, and can be expensive. Chemical therapies with careful crack and crevice applications and cleaning in voids cost much less yet need numerous visits. A business that offers both, or that companions with a specialist, is normally a lot more flexible and straightforward about trade-offs.

Price, worth, and the expense of inexpensive promises

Pricing varies by area and infestation. For a regular single-family home, basic pest control may run 300 to 600 dollars per year for quarterly service. Bed insect jobs often range from 750 to 2,500 bucks depending on areas and approach. Termite lure syst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 bucks for install, plus yearly surveillance charges, while soil treatments for a mid-sized home may run 1,200 to 2,500 bucks. Rodent exemption can vary hugely, from a couple of hundred for sealing small voids to numerous thousand for hefty architectural work.

The least expensive proposal can be a trap. Below are the questions I ask when two proposals are far apart:

  • What specifically is consisted of in the preliminary service and the follow-ups? How many check outs and on what schedule?
  • Which products or methods will you utilize, at what areas, and why those over alternatives?
  • What problems do you require me to address, and exactly how will we validate that each side did their part?
  • What does your warranty pledge and omit, and how do I ask for a retreat?
  • Who will be my ongoing specialist, and how do I reach them in between visits?

If the reduced proposal includes less check outs, much less tracking, or no range for exemption, it is not apples to apples. Often, a higher bid covers fixings, sealing, and hygiene tools that protect against persisting expenses. On one multifamily building, a firm recommended adhesive catches and monthly spray downs for mice. An additional proposal was 40 percent higher and included securing 35 penetrations, installing door sweeps, and getting rid of the dumpster overflow. The 2nd plan minimized call-backs by 90 percent within 2 months, and the total year expense was lower.

Red flags that anticipate headaches

Most issues I have seen after the truth were foreseeable from the very first get in touch with. Firms that guarantee a long-term fix to an open environment trouble, like computer mice in a city rowhouse with collapsing mortar, are marketing hope, not a service. Assurances that consist of numerous exemptions, such as "no protection for re-infestation from bordering units," are not always poor, but they need to be clarified, not concealed behind fine print. If a sales representative stands up to jotting down information, prevent them. If a technician is reluctant to reveal you product labels or safety and security data sheets upon request, maintain your budget in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ly plans that assert to cover every little thing without inspection costs or attachments. When you review the contract, you may discover that bed pests, termites, wild animals, and German cockroaches are omitted. That sort of strategy has its place, especially for seasonal ants or periodic crawlers, however it will not help with high-pressure pests.

Another warning sign is overspray or unnecessary broad applications. If you see a professional fogging the walls in every space for ants, they are dealing with the sign, not the cause. The nest is outside. That chemical does bit greater than leave residue where your children and pets live. You want targeted lures, split and crevice applications behind switch plates, or perimeter perimeter treatments that address the path, not inside misting for show.

Contracts and assurances that mean something

A good warranty has clear triggers and treatments. It must specify the covered parasites, how much time coverage lasts, what re-treatments cost, and what activities invalidate the assurance. For termites, you will certainly see repair assurances, retreat-only assurances, or crossbreed versions. Repair warranties can be important if you trust the company's durability and their procedure, however they are frequently a lot more pricey. Retreat-only can be completely great if you monitor annually and preserve a record of tidy inspections.

Read for transferability and cancellation terms. If you plan to sell within a number of years, a transferable termite bond can help the sale. On the other hand, some basic pest control contracts auto-renew with stiff cancellation costs. If you see early termination charges that go beyond the rest of the solution value, bargain or walk.

Payment terms tell you regarding a firm's self-confidence. Reasonable down payments for significant job are regular. Full early repayment for unrendered solutions is not, unless a discount rate compensates and you rely on the service provider. For bed insects, suppliers occasionally stage repayments throughout gos to, which straightens incentives.

Safety and environmental considerations without the slogans

Homeowners often request for "environment-friendly" options. The term is obscure. What issues is direct exposure, not marketing language. The best pest control minimizes the need for chemicals via exclusion and sanitation, then makes use of the least-toxic efficient item in the tiniest amount, in the most targeted place, for the fastest time. That might be a desiccant dust in a wall space, a gel bait under a counter top lip, or a development regulator in a drainpipe. For mosquitoes, it may be larvicide in standing water and a dealt with grade for runoff.

Ask the technician to stroll you via the products they plan to use. Read the active ingredients on the tag, not simply the brand name. If you have pet dogs, aquariums, or youngsters with bronchial asthma, say so early. Good companies note those information in your documents and adjust solutions and application techniques. I have actually seen technicians exchange out pyrethroids near fish tanks or stay clear of aerosol carriers near oxygen devices. These are tiny modifications that make a big difference.

Ventilation after treatment is normally straightforward. Basic open-window timeframes, often 30 to 60 minutes, suffice for numerous indoor applications. For warmth therapies, they will set the time and surveillance tools. For sulfuryl fluoride fumigations, which are unusual for single-family homes outside of certain termite or whole-structure circumstances, the safety and security methods are strict, with clear re-entry times. If your service provider seems laid-back concerning re-entry, that is a concern.

Comparing quotes: a useful means to line them up

Paperwork from pest control companies is notoriously tough to compare. One checklists every chemical with portion toughness, another offers a pleasant recap regarding "multi-point security," and the 3rd provides a single number and a signature line. Create a basic grid on your own. Compose bug type, therapy approach, number of sees, included repair work or sealing, checking routine, assurance terms, total expense, and optional attachments. Call each supplier back and fill in any blanks.

During the callback, pay attention to exactly how they manage your inquiries. Do they obtain defensive or insightful? Do they send out modified ranges in creating? I collaborated with a property supervisor who picked suppliers based upon their responsiveness throughout this stage, not just reward or referrals. The reasoning was sound. If they communicate plainly when trying to gain your service, they will possibly do so throughout service.

When wild animals sneaks into the picture

Not every pest control service manages wildlife. Squirrels in the attic,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ft need a various license in several states and a different skill set. Wildlife control focuses on humane trapping, one-way doors, and repair work of entrance points, often followed by sanitizing polluted insulation. If you suspect wild animals, ask straight whether the exterminator company has that capability or companions with a wildlife expert. A general pest control service technician who establishes a few catches without securing accessibility points will certainly create a cycle of return check outs without resolution.

What readiness resembles on your side

Clients influence end results. A tidy, obtainable, and well-prepared home permits professionals to bring their ideal work. For cockroaches, bag and eliminate the pantry products the evening prior to so they can access gaps and joints. For bed bugs, follow the prep listing specifically, however beware of over-prepping. Nabbing every product and moving small furniture throughout rooms can disperse insects. A great business will certainly offer details, determined instructions such as laundering bed linens on high warm, decluttering under beds, and leaving furnishings in position for proper treatment.

In services, coordinating gain access to and holding both lessee and property owner responsible issues as high as therapy choice. In one building with repeating cockroach problems, the supervisor wrote prep instructions in three languages, included picture-based overviews on exactly how to clear closets, and sent out a personnel the day before to aid senior residents lift light things. Therapy effectiveness boosted by fifty percent without transforming chemicals.

The function of innovation without the buzzwords

Remote screens, wise catches, and electronic reporting have made pest control much easier to confirm. I do not employ a service provider for gizmos, however I appreciate business that record what they did, where, and when. An easy photo of a secured space, a map of lure terminals with solution days, or a log of catch checks informs me the plan was executed. Some service providers offer customer portals with solution reports and item tags. That openness helps when personnel modification or when you market the property.

Seasonality, regional peculiarities, and special cases

Pest stress is not uniform.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ites use continuous stress. In the Southwest, scorpions and roof covering rats produce different patterns. In the Northeast, rodents surge in loss as temperatures decrease. High altitude communities see collection flies congregate on south-facing walls in late summer season. Your selection of pest control company should reflect regional experience. Ask what seasonal insects they anticipate and how they change timetables. A quarterly schedule might change to bi-monthly during peak months and twice a year in winter, or the contrary for certain pests.

For historical homes, porous stone structures and balloon framework make complex exclusion. You might need a service provider that understands how to secure without suffocating, just how to maintain air flow while blocking entrance, and how to deal with timber participants sensitively. For eco-friendly roofs or pollinator yards, you desire a team that can protect valuable insects while attending to pests that intimidate people and structures.

References and reputation that go deeper than celebrity ratings

Online evaluates help, but they squash subtlety. Seek patterns over years, not just a high score last month. A firm with hundreds of reviews throughout five or more years and thorough comments regarding particular parasites is a much safer wager than a handful of radiant notes that sound like advertising and marketing. Request two recommendations for the bug you are managing. When you call, ask what went wrong first, after that ask just how the company responded. Straightforward business make errors, and the way they recover informs you more than excellence claims.

Local property supervisors, dining establishment proprietors, and home inspectors can be honest sources. They see specialists functioning when there is no sales pitch. If multiple pros point out the exact same name with regard, pay attention.

When national chains versus local operators is not the real question

Large exterminator companies bring standardization, much deeper bench stamina, and commonly quicker emergency action. Local pest control service providers bring adaptability, partnerships, and occasionally sharper prices. I have employed both. The far better concern is in shape. Does the particular branch or owner have the professional top quality, insect experience, and service society your situation demands? Some of the best termite treatments I have actually seen were from tiny companies that treat hundreds of homes each year in one area. A few of the most effective multi-site rodent programs originated from nationwide suppliers with data-driven organizing and dedicated account managers. Avoid stereotypes and judge the group that will actually offer you.

A small checklist for your last choice

  • Verify licenses, insurance coverage, and experience with your specific pest, and request current task counts and re-treatment rates.
  • Evaluate the assessment top quality: time on site, areas inspected, searchings for discussed, and pictures or notes provided.
  • Compare created ranges: techniques, items, go to matters, consisted of exemption or fixings, and keeping an eye on frequency.
  • Understand warranties and contracts: covered insects, duration, solutions, exclusions, renewal and cancellation terms.
  • Assess communication: responsiveness, clearness in solutions, willingness to customize, and documents practices.

When you stack firms versus this list, the right selection usually ends up being apparent. The rate may still matter, however you will be selecting value, not betting on the most inexpensive line item.

Living with the solution

The best pest control really feels uneventful after the initial flurry. You quit seeing ants on the counter. The scratching at 2 a.m. goes peaceful. The glue boards stay tidy. More notably, you recognize what problems would certainly bring the issue back and how to avoid them. You might maintain mulch pulled back from the foundation by six inches, include door sweeps in loss, repair a slow leakage under a vanity, or add a suggestion to tidy floor drains regular monthly. The pest control service ends up being a partner, not a firefighter.

I think of a bakeshop I helped a number of years back, a limited room with endless flour dust and cozy stoves, a heaven for pests. The proprietor cycled through 3 providers in one year prior to discovering a business whose technician knew flour moths and German cockroaches as well as he understood bread dough. They modified production routines to permit targeted therapies on low-traffic mornings, set up p-trap inserts, and set pheromone displays in dry storage. The specialist left short, legible notes after each visit and adjusted lures based upon catch matters. The proprietor's team found out to seek very early indications and call early. 2 years later on, they still pay a regular monthly charge that is not the least expensive around, but they determine value in silent traps and clean wellness inspections.

That is the requirement. Not magic. Not advertising and marketing. Simply careful inspection, honest preparation, competent application, and constant follow-through from a pest control company that treats your residential or commercial property like it is their very own. If you compare exterminator services keeping that goal in mind, you will certainly work with like a professional and rest without the scratching.

Frequently Asked Questions About Pest Control


How much does pest control cost in Orlando?

Typical general pest control in Orlando is often priced as either a one-time treatment or a recurring plan. One-time visits commonly fall in the low hundreds of dollars, depending on the pest, home size, and infestation severity. Recurring quarterly service usually lowers the per-visit cost but increases annual total cost. Specialty problems like termites, bed bugs, or wildlife exclusion can cost substantially more than general pest service.

How much would it cost for pest control?

Pest control cost depends mainly on the target pest, property size, access, and how established the infestation is. General pest treatments are usually priced lower than specialized services like termites or bed bugs. Recurring maintenance plans typically cost less per visit than one-time treatments. Quotes can vary widely because treatment methods and included follow-ups differ.

What are the top 5 pest companies?

“Top 5” depends on what is being measured (price, coverage area, customer reviews, warranty terms, or specialty expertise). Rankings also differ by region because local operators may outperform national firms in service quality. A reliable way to identify top providers is to compare state licensing status, complaint history, and large-sample review trends across multiple platforms. The “best” choice often varies by pest type (e.g., termites vs. rodents vs. bed bugs).

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

What kind of pest control is cheapest?

The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.

What are signs you need an exterminator?

Signs include repeated sightings of live pests, droppings, persistent bites or skin reactions consistent with pests, and property damage such as gnawed wires or chewed materials. Recurring problems after DIY treatments often indicate the source is not being addressed. Unusual odors, nests, or persistent noises in walls can suggest hidden infestations. Professional identification matters because treatments differ by species and behavior.

How much is pest control in a house?

For a typical house, general pest control commonly ranges from a low-hundreds one-time visit to a recurring plan billed monthly or quarterly. Pricing changes with square footage, infestation severity, and whether follow-up visits are included. Specialty services like termites, bed bugs, and wildlife exclusion often cost much more than routine insect control. The lowest-cost option is usually preventive maintenance when there is no established infestation.

What is the most effective pest control?

The most effective approach is integrated pest management (IPM), which combines inspection, sanitation, exclusion, targeted treatment, and ongoing monitoring. Effectiveness comes from removing the conditions that allow pests to survive, not only killing visible pests. Targeted methods (baits, growth regulators, exclusion, and limited-use sprays) are selected based on the pest’s biology and entry points. Long-term results depend on preventing re-entry and reducing food, water, and shelter.

How often should pest control come in Florida?

In Florida, many households use quarterly service for general prevention because pests are active year-round in warm, humid conditions. Some situations justify monthly visits, such as heavy pressure, recurring activity, or specific pest issues. Termite risk is often managed with periodic inspections and ongoing monitoring systems rather than only “spray” visits. The right frequency depends on pest history, construction type, and surrounding environment.
